Description
This Easy Fajita Casserole is a flavorful and hearty dish combining shredded chicken, sautéed vegetables, black beans, corn, and a blend of spices layered with crunchy tortilla strips and melted cheese. Perfect for a family meal, it’s baked to golden perfection and provides a comforting twist on traditional fajitas in a convenient casserole form.
Ingredients
Scale
Filling
- 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
- 1 bell pepper, sliced
- 1 onion, sliced
- 1 can black be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 cup corn (frozen or canned)
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 cup salsa
- Salt and pepper to taste
Toppings & Base
- 2 cups shredded cheese (cheddar or Mexican blend)
- 6 tortillas, cut into strips
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) to ensure it’s ready for baking the casserole.
- Mix the Filling: In a large m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, sliced bell pepper, sliced onion, drained black beans, corn, ch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, salsa, and half of the shredded cheese. Stir together until well mixed and evenly coated with spices and salsa.
- Prepare the Base: In a casserole dish, layer half of the tortilla strips evenly on the bottom to create a crunchy base for the casserole.
- Layer the Filling: Spread the chicken and vegetable mixture evenly over the tortilla base layer in the dish.
- Add the Top Layer: Place the remaining tortilla strips on top of the filling to add additional texture.
- Add Cheese Topping: Sprinkle the remaining shredded cheese evenly over the top of the casserole to create a melty, golden crust when baked.
- Bake: Place the assembled casserole into the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
- Rest and Serve: Allow the casserole to cool for a few minutes before serving to let flavors meld and ensure easy slicing.
Notes
- Best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for 3-4 days.
- Reheat leftovers in the oven to maintain the crispy texture and melty cheese.
- Feel free to substitute chicken with turkey or a plant-based protein for variation.
- Adjust the spice level by adding diced jalapeños or extra chili powder if you like heat.
